Peace and good will is no where water bomb is emerging as a new possible irritant between china and India, Chinese move to approve construction of three more dams. On Brahmaputra river in Tibet, in addition to the one being built without informing New Delhi is serious threat and vilation. Water also the poteintial to become a divisive issue in India’s bilateral relation with China. New Delhi is concerned about the ecological impact on India of Chinese plans to divert the river of Tibet for irrigation purposes in China. With China controlling the Tibetan Plateau, the sources of Asia’s major rivers, the potential for conflict over increasingly scare water resources remains concern.
